Stock Photo - 15 September 2021, Baden-Wuerttemberg, Ulm: A battery-powered Nikola truck exits a steep curve on the test track at Iveco's Donautal plant. Commercial vehicle manufacturer Iveco has opened a production hall for electrically powered trucks in Ulm. Together with the US e-car start-up Nikola, the company aims to produce up to 3000 trucks a year in the medium term. In addition to the electric truck, the two companies also unveiled a truck powered by fuel cells. Photo: Stefan Puchner/dpa. - Ulm/Baden-Wuerttemberg/Germany
